B.Com Accounting & Finance – Foundation for a Successful Commerce Career


The Bachelor of Commerce in Accounting & Finance is a popular undergraduate degree for students who aim to pursue careers in finance, taxation, auditing, or corporate management. The course seeks to provide a comprehensive foundation in subjects such as finance, economics, auditing, taxation, and business law.

Graduates with a B.Com Accounting & Finance degree can pursue roles like financial analyst, accountant, internal auditor, banking associate, or tax consultant. Many also choose to continue higher studies in professional courses like Chartered Accountancy (CA), Cost and Management Accountancy (CMA), or MBA for better career advancement.

The increasing requirement for finance professionals in both private and government organisations guarantees steady demand and attractive salary packages for graduates in this field.

MBA in Health Care Management – Leadership in the Medical Industry


An MBA in Healthcare Management is a unique postgraduate programme ideal for students interested in combining business management skills with healthcare operations. With the healthcare sector expanding rapidly in India, this degree trains professionals for managerial roles in medical, insurance, and healthcare administration sectors.

The curriculum includes health economics, hospital administration, medical ethics, marketing, and financial management. Students develop the skills to handle healthcare systems effectively while maintaining service quality and compliance.

Career opportunities after an MBA in Health Care Management include roles such as hospital administrator, health project manager, operations executive, and healthcare consultant. This programme offers both career advancement and the reward of contributing to better healthcare delivery systems across the country.

B.Sc Zoology – Understanding the World of Animals


For students fascinated by biological sciences, a B.Sc Zoology degree offers deep insights into the animal kingdom, its structure, function, and evolution. This 3-year undergraduate programme includes subjects like genetics, ecology, cell biology, and evolutionary studies.

Graduates can find roles within research laboratories, wildlife conservation organisations, ecological institutions, or pursue higher studies such BSc Zoology as postgraduate and doctoral programmes. The scope of Zoology studies expands into fields like environmental management, biotechnology, and bioinformatics, where zoologists make significant contributions in sustainable development and scientific innovation.

Microbiologist Salary and Career Outlook in India


Microbiology is a rapidly growing field that plays an essential role in biotechnology, medicine, and environmental sciences. A microbiologist’s salary in India depends on factors such as education, expertise, and job sector. Entry-level microbiologists typically earn between ?3–5 lakhs per annum, while experienced professionals working in advanced scientific roles can earn significantly higher packages.

Those with advanced degrees (M.Sc or Ph.D.) often work in research institutions, universities, or industrial labs. With increasing focus on health, vaccines, and environmental protection, the demand for skilled microbiologists is steadily increasing.

Diploma in Computer Science Syllabus – Gateway to the IT Industry


A Diploma in Computer Science offers a practical and technical foundation for students pursuing careers in information technology and programming. The syllabus for Diploma in Computer Science typically covers subjects such as programming, networking, and software development concepts.

This course trains students for entry-level positions such as software technician, junior programmer, or IT support executive. It is an ideal choice for those looking to build a career in technology without pursuing a full engineering degree. After completing the diploma, students can also advance to B.Tech or B.Sc in Computer Science for career progression.
